Case Summary: CWP No. 7790/2026 The court granted an interim stay on Anuradha Gupta's transfer from Solan Zone to Karnal Zone, finding it prima facie violated UCO Bank's Transfer Policy. The policy requires five years continuous tenure in a zone for inter-zone transfers, but Solan Zone only became independent on 01.07.2025—insufficient time had elapsed. The petitioner is permitted to continue at her present posting pending further orders. Next hearing: 18.06.2026.
